摘要:
In order to make further progress with the solution of multimachine transient problems, it is necessary to augment the facilities of network analysers, the most convenient of the analytical tools available to the power-system engineer. The paper describes a new simulator which enables the symmetrical a.c. transient component of current or voltage of a synchronous machine, subsequent to any 3-phase disturbance, to be obtained. The simulator is based on the duals of equivalent circuits for the direct and quadrature axes of synchronous machines, and is entirely electronic in its operation.Experimental results are given and a comparison is drawn between these and the results obtained by calculation. It is concluded that such a simulator is an essential preliminary step towards a more accurate representation of machines and their associated apparatus, either individually or when interconnected in a power system.

摘要:
The paper describes certain experiments designed to investigate the mode of penetration of tooth-ripple flux pulsations in smooth laminated pole-shoes. Simple measurements made by means of search coils embedded in holes drilled axially at different radial depths from the pole face have revealed that a dynamic mode of flux pulsation, which corresponds to the static tooth-flux distribution, persists, at significant amplitude, at the normal operating speed of the machine. Measurements have been made with two sets of laminations of different thickness and material at a range of tooth-ripple frequencies. The results provide substantial evidence in support of an analysis of tooth-ripple phenomena contained in a companion paper.

摘要:
Classical linear electromagnetic theory is used to investigate the mode of penetration of tooth-ripple flux into smooth laminated poleshoes, without making any assumption as to the thickness of the laminations employed. It is shown that, apart from the mode corresponding to the classical ‘depth of penetration’ concept, there also exists a completely different mode which penetrates to a much larger radial depth but has a non-uniform distribution across the thickness of the laminations, the maximum values occurring at the interfaces. With thicknesses usually employed in practice, at least 60% of toothripple eddy-current loss is found to arise from this latter mode of penetration, so that only a fraction of the total loss could properly be called a ‘pole-face’ loss.

摘要:
In a previous paper1expressions were obtained for the distortion of the modulation when a frequency-modulated wave passes through network whose group-delay and amplitude characteristics both exhibit small departures from constancy. An ideal discriminator network has the property that when it is fed with a frequency-modulated wave the amplitude modulation of the output is an exact copy (except for scale factor) of the frequency modulation of the input. This can be achieved by a network whose group-delay characteristic is constant and whose amplitude characteristic is linear. In the present paper the theory given in the previous paper is extended to cover discriminator networks whose characteristics exhibit small departures from these ideal forms. Single-tone and noise-band modulations are considered. Two numerical examples are given, one being a design of 2-tuned-circuit discriminator, which is considered in relation to a 240-channel f.d.m. telephony system, and the other is an improved balanced discriminator suitable for a 600-channel system.

摘要:
The dispersion characteristics of periodically loaded waveguides are examined. As is well known, a loaded waveguide has the properties of a filter having infinitely many stop bands, which occur when the phase change per section for the wave is a multiple of π. For linear accelerator and other applications it is sometimes desirable to operate the structure in the π-mode but the resulting zero group velocity raises considerable difficulties.In the first part of the paper it is shown how a finite group velocity at the π-mode frequency can be obtained in a waveguide loaded with solid dielectric discs. This is accomplished by making the discs reflectionless at the required frequency; the stop band being thus eliminated, the structure can be regarded as a confluent band-pass filter.To permit the passage of an electron beam it is necessary for the discs to have central holes. Evanescent and other propagating modes are set up, but it is shown in the latter part of the paper that it is still possible to operate the structure in the π-mode with a finite group velocity. This result cannot be obtained if the guide is loaded by thin metal discs, as used in most present-day linear accelerators.

摘要:
A multi-element directional coupler is considered as a cascaded set of 2-element directional couplers, each of which, at the design frequency, is perfect in match and directivity. A characteristic impedance matrix and a voltage transfer matrix may be defined for each of the basic 2-element couplers, and these are analogous to the characteristic impedance and the propagation coefficient in iterative 4-terminal network theory.The voltage transfer matrix is shown to be a linear function of the cosine and sine of a certain angle which is related in a simple way to the coupling factor of the elemental coupler. This function has algebraic properties analogous to those of complex numbers. In particular, the use of de Moivre's theorem is shown greatly to simplify the design of multi-element couplers. An example is given of the design of a 5-slot 3 dB coupler (a binomial slot hybrid).

摘要:
The influence of the magnitude of network parameters on the waveform generated by the simplest types of circuit used in high-voltage impulse testing has been discussed at some length in the literature. These treatises are based, however, on simplifying assumptions not absolutely necessary, and no attempt appears to have been made to develop a unified approach to this problem. Moreover, some important circuits of slightly greater complexity have received particularly scanty attention, ostensibly on the grounds of mathematical complication.The present paper introduces a unified treatment, without approximations, and with application to the more complex as well as to the simplest circuits. It indicates how one of the former may be employed to achieve higher efficiencies, coupled with increased economy of parts, particularly where resistive potential dividers are used. Some light is also thrown on the discrepancy between the nominal and actual rise times of double-exponential impulse waves.
